PROVO -- BYU football concluded its final regular practice before a scrimmage on Wednesday wraps up fall camp.

“Every player knowing their role and what might be expected of them,” said BYU head coach Bronco Mendenhall on the transition from fall camp to regular season practices. “I’m talking mostly about the younger players now. The clearer they are with the role they’re playing, the quicker the chemistry and the quicker our scout work and game preparation come.”

The Cougars ran a shortened 11-on-11 segment on Tuesday, with freshman quarterback Jake Heaps running one drive and junior quarterback Riley Nelson under snap for two.

Heaps completed a short pass to senior wide receiver Luke Ashworth and junior running back J.J. Di Luigi had a two-yard run. On third down, senior linebacker Shane Hunter intercepted a pass to end the drive.

The offense came back to score a touchdown on a 70-yard drive as Nelson went 6-of-6 for 62 yards. After completing passes to junior Spencer Hafoka and freshman Joshua Quezada, Nelson pitched the ball out to freshman Ryan Folsom on an option left for a gain of 10 yards.

Senior B.J. Peterson, Quezada and sophomore Rhen Brown snagged three consecutive completions before a fumbled snap pushed the offense back two yards to the 15-yard line. On the next play, Nelson found junior Matt Marshall down the middle of the field for the touchdown.

On the final possession, Di Luigi and junior Bryan Kariya each had a short run before a pass breakup by freshman defensive back Jordan Johnson ended the session.

The team will scrimmage on Wednesday before beginning preparations on Thursday to play Washington on Saturday, Aug. 4.
